      <title>Dynatrace SaaS - URL Cleanup: View individual requests</title>
      <link>https://community.dynatrace.com/t5/Real-User-Monitoring/Dynatrace-SaaS-URL-Cleanup-View-individual-requests/m-p/52507#M6504</link>
      <description>&lt;P data-unlink="true"&gt;If we apply a URL cleanup rule to a URL for something like this: www.mywebapp.com/static/uniqueStuff/morestatic.aspx&lt;/P&gt;
&lt;P&gt;to look like this&lt;/P&gt;
&lt;P data-unlink="true"&gt;www.mywebapp.com/static/.../morestatic.aspx&lt;/P&gt;
&lt;P&gt;Are we still able to view each request with the 'uniqueStuff' still visible or has it simply grouped all the transactions to look exactly the same?&lt;/P&gt;
&lt;P&gt;I'm trying to get it so that we are doing a URL cleanup so that we can see overall transaction health but then can still zoom in to a particular unique URL for troubleshooting.&lt;/P&gt;</description>

      <title>Re: Dynatrace SaaS - URL Cleanup: View individual requests</title>
      <link>https://community.dynatrace.com/t5/Real-User-Monitoring/Dynatrace-SaaS-URL-Cleanup-View-individual-requests/m-p/52508#M6505</link>
      <description>&lt;P&gt;If you look at individual user actions (instances) in the waterfall you will still see the full url for the resource details. Later this year you will be also see the full url in the user session details.&lt;/P&gt;</description>
